원본보기 아이콘On the last day of the Chuseok holiday, which also marked the first opening of the Mudeungsan summit in two years, it was estimated that more than 15,000 people visited the mountain.
According to the Mudeungsan National Park Office on October 10, a total of about 15,000 visitors came to Mudeungsan on the 9th. Of these, around 4,000 people took the course from the columnar joints at Seoseokdae, passing through Jiwangbong and Inwangbong, and exited through the main gate of the military base.
The average daily number of visitors this year, including weekends, has been around 8,000. On the day the summit was opened, the number of visitors increased by 87.5% compared to the average. This figure is also about 50% higher than the daily average of 10,000 during the peak autumn foliage season.
This opening of the Mudeungsan summit was the first in two years since 2023, and it was held to wish for the re-certification of the UNESCO Global Geopark in 2026 and to attract the national artificial intelligence computing center.

원본보기 아이콘Access to the summit of Mudeungsan has been restricted to the public since 1966 due to the presence of a military base. Since the first opening event in 2011, which attracted around 20,000 visitors, the summit has been opened a total of 27 times through this year, with cumulative visitors reaching approximately 502,000.
